Role of Rhodamine B in Scientific Research and Its Market Implications
Scientific and medical research forms a burgeoning segment within the Rhodamine B Market, particularly in fluorescence microscopy and flow cytometry. The dye’s ability to bind with biological molecules and emit intense fluorescence makes it vital in cell biology, molecular diagnostics, and cancer research. For instance, adoption of Rhodamine B in labelling techniques has increased by approximately 8% annually, reflecting its growing indispensability in these fields. Consequently, the Rhodamine B Market is increasingly driven by advancements in life sciences, which demand precise, reliable fluorescent markers.

Market Segmentation by Form and Grade in the Rhodamine B Market
Within the Rhodamine B Market, segmentation by form—powder, liquid, and paste—indicates powder as the most widely used, favored for ease of transport and storage. Powder form commands over 50% of the market share, particularly in textile dyeing and industrial applications. Meanwhile, liquid and paste forms are gaining traction in specialty applications requiring precise dosing and consistent dispersion, such as in biomedical research and fluorescent inks. Similarly, segmentation by grade divides the market into industrial and laboratory grades. Industrial-grade Rhodamine B dominates in volume terms, while laboratory-grade, which requires higher purity and fluorescence efficiency, is expanding at a faster rate due to growing scientific research applications.
Rhodamine B Price and Rhodamine B Price Trend: Impact of Raw Material Fluctuations
The Rhodamine B Price is subject to fluctuations influenced by raw material availability, production costs, and regional demand-supply dynamics. For instance, the cost of precursor chemicals such as xanthene derivatives directly impacts Rhodamine B Price, with increases in raw material prices leading to upward pressure on finished product costs. Over the past three years, the Rhodamine B Price Trend has shown moderate volatility, with price hikes averaging 4-5% annually in response to supply chain constraints and rising energy costs. Additionally, geopolitical factors affecting chemical supply chains, particularly in Asia, have contributed to temporary price surges, underscoring the market’s sensitivity to external disruptions.
